About the Item

This 19th-century Kerman Lavar carpet presents a refined interplay of muted beige, terracotta, soft blue, and charcoal tones arranged in a richly layered medallion layout. Its surface reveals a dense network of scrolling vines, palmettes, and botanical motifs, all rendered with the fine detail characteristic of high-quality Lavar weaving from this period. From a distance, the carpet forms a balanced architectural composition anchored by four corner medallion spandrels supporting a central floral medallion. Up close, the pattern reveals a tapestry of delicate outlines softened by age, giving the piece a distinctive patina that collectors deeply value. The palette—subdued yet complex—makes this carpet highly versatile, complementing both traditional and contemporary interiors. The craftsmanship suggests a workshop known for precision drawing and controlled symmetry, with the design flowing continuously across the field before settling into multiple framed borders. These borders accumulate layers of floral ornamentation, enhancing the sense of structure and visual depth. This piece is well-suited for large living spaces, libraries, or formal rooms where its scale and nuanced coloration can be fully appreciated. It is clean, professionally maintained, and ready for installation.
